可行性研究报告
1、 引言
1.1编写目的
为了提高机房收费的管理水平,达到节约时间,提高效率,快捷高效的管理目的,从而降低人力、物力、财力消耗。本次编写主要目的是为了分析廊坊师范学院是否具备研发机房收费系统的必要性与可能性。预期的读者为系统管理人员、开发人员和维护人员。
1.2背景
随着网络技术的快速发展,网络化学习已经是大势所趋,学校机房成了学生上网学习的主要信息场所。学生上机自主化学习是一个不可缺少的的环节,但随之而来的确是一系列的机房管理问题,如考勤,收费等问题。而机房收费系统就是为满足机房收费管理这一要求而设计的,不仅可以降低机房的运营成本提高效率,而且方便准确快捷,为我们的教育管理带来了极大的便利。
A.软件名称:机房收费系统
B.任务提出者:米新江教授
开发者:周家林
用户:教师、学生、机房管理员
实现该软件的计算中心或计算机网络:学校机房
C.该软件同其他系统或机构的基本来往关系:由廊坊师范学院信息技术提高班做技术支持
1.3定义
Visual Basic是一种由微软公司开发的包含协助开发环境的事件驱动编程语言。从任何标准来说,VB都是世界上使用人数最多的语言——不仅是盛赞VB的开发者还是抱怨VB的开发者的数量。它源自于BASIC编程语言。VB拥有图形用户界面(GUI)和快速应用程序开发(RAD)系统,可以轻易的使用DAO、RDO、ADO连接数据库,或者轻松的创建ActiveX控件。程序员可以轻松的使用VB提供的组件快速建立一个应用程序。
Microsoft SQL Server 是一个全面的数据库平台,使用集成的商业智能 (BI)工具提供了企业级的数据管理。Microsoft SQL Server 数据库引擎为关系型数据和结构化数据提供了更安全可靠的存储功能,使您可以构建和管理用于业务的高可用和高性能的数据应用程序。
1.4参考资料
1. SQL sever视频 耿建玲 浙江大学
2. SQL sever 数据库红皮书
3. 软件工程视频张* 哈尔滨工业大学
4. 可行性研究报告(GB8567——88)
2.1要求
A.功能:
计时:登录成功开始计时,一直到退出系统
计费:根据计时模式和计费方式,计算相应的上机费用
考勤:根据计时模式记录学生上下机情况,打印考勤表
维护:系统故障、断电等引起的系统不稳定,实行强制下机
B.性能:机房上机准备时间为两分钟,不足半小时按半小时扣费,基本数据管理员可以随时修改,实时查看学生上机情况。
C.输出:
用户列表:用于管理员对用户信息的管理
日结账单:实现每日账目的汇总,向上级领导汇报
周结账单:实现每周账目的汇总,向上级领导汇报
考勤记录表:学生、操作人员、管理人员的上下机和执勤情况
系统错误报告:记录系统出错的时间,错误类型,为系统维护人员参考。
D.输入:
用户信息:新开账户的初始信息,包括账号,卡号,姓名,初始金额等,存入账户数据库中。
金额:账户充值时改变数据库中的金额。
验证信息:账户登录时所需的登录验证信息,如账户和密码等。
E.数据流程和处理流程:根据注册卡号进行上机,记录上机时间、下机时间,根据时间判断所收费用。
F.安全与保密方面的要求:用户信息只有用户自己和管理员可见,所有信息只有管理员可修改
G.同本系统相连接的其他系统:学生信息系统
H.完成期限:14天
2.2目标
A.提高学院机房管理的效率。
B.方便学生上机学习。
C.有效的管理学校机房的使用。
2.3条件、假定和限制
A.系统运行寿命的最小值:4年。
B.经费来源:学校财务部对计算机部的预留资金
C.硬件条件:廊坊师范学院的机房设备和网络设备
运行环境: WIN7或者WIN8及以上系统
开发环境:Visual Basic6.0,SQL 2008
D.可利用的信息和资源:学生信息管理系统
E.系统投入使用的最晚时间:2015年8月10日
2.4进行可行性研究的方法
本次可行性研究主要通过调查研究法。在米新江教授的带领下对师范学院的机房使用情况做了调查。为了提高机房管理的效率,以减少不必要的人力物力消耗。
2.5评价尺度
开发费用:开发经费预定在1000元之内
各项功能的优先次序:满足管理员、操作员和一般用户的使用
开发时间:在一个月之内完成开发和测试工作
使用中的难易程度:尽量从简,方便任何人使用
3对现有系统的分析
3.1处理流程和数据流程
说明现有系统的基本的处理流程和数据流程。此流程可用图表
即流程图的形式表示,并加以叙述。
暂无
3.2工作负荷
列出现有系统所承担的工作及工作量。
暂无
3.3费用开支
列出由于运行现有系统所引起的费用开支,如人力、设备、空间、支持性服务、材料等项开支以及开 支总额。 无
3.4人员
列出为了现有系统的运行和维护所需要的人员的专业技术类别和数量。大量人力,无智能化系统
3.5设备
列出现有系统所使用的各种设备。人力、物力
3.6局限性
列出本系统的主要的局限性,例如处理时间赶不上需要,响应不及时,数据存储能力不足,处理功能 不够等。并且要说明,为什么对现有系统的改进性维护已经不能解决问题。
4所建议的系统
本章将用来说明所建议系统的目标和要求将如何被满足。
4.1对所建议系统的说明
建议系统可实现上机收费智能化,极大的方便了广大师生上机
实现方法:SQL知识进行对该系统进行开
4.2处理流程和数据流程
学生注册卡、充值、上机、下机、退卡,管理员日结账、周结账
4.3改进之处
所建议的系统与现有的系统比较包括如下几方面改进之处:界面清晰简单,易于操作;等级明显,易于管理机房;
4.4影响
在建立所建议系统时,预期会带来的影响包括以下几个方面
4.4.1对设备的影响
由于本系统开发时,需要一定的软件和技术,所以设备需要符合的要求
4.4.2对软件的影响
要运行机房收费系统,必须保证操作系统在XP以上,现有的系
统需要统一升级,以适应新要求的需要,有助于机房收费系统的流畅运行。
4.4.3对用户单位机构的影响
为了运行所建议的系统,需要值班教师熟悉windows操作系统的一些基本知识。
4.4.4对系统运行过程中的影响
本系统提供帮助,按照系统的提示进行操作,如果失效后,数据库恢复到最新更新的备份状态。
4.4.5对开发的影响
开发过程中,需要不断的与机房管理人员沟通,不断的完善改进系统,以适应用户需求。
4.4.6对地点和设施的影响
学校的计算机机房即可,机器需要是XP系统以上系统。
4.4.7对经费开支的影响
从经济效益来分析,软件的开发成本不大,而其它的投入也只是
电脑。由于学校的电脑已经普及,所以系统运行的基础环境已经具备,无需重新开发建设,所以系统开发、运行所需的费用是比较低的。
4.5局限性
由于本开发小组第一次做比较正规的开发,没有实战经验,可能有一些问题考虑得不是太全面,难免会有遗漏的地方。
4.6技术条件方面的可行性
A.开发系统采用Visual Basic6.0开发语言和SQL 2008,预期
能够准确开发完成系统。
B.开发人员经过一年多专业方面的学习,拥有一定的经验和扎实的基础。
C.在规定期限内,能够顺利完成任务。
5 可供选择的其他系统方案
暂无
6投资及效益分
6.1支出
对于所选择的方案,说明所需的费用。如果已有一个现存的系统,包括系统继续运行期间所需的费用。
6.1.1基本建设投资
a. PC机1台:4000元;
b. 开发工具:500元;
c. 数据库管理软件:500元;
d. 安全与保密设备:1000元;
总计:6000元
6.1.2其他一次性支出
a. 系统研究:500元。
b. 开发计划与测量基准的研究:500元
c. 数据库的建立:1000元
d. 检查费用和技术管理性费用:1000元
e. 培训费以及开发安装人员所需要的一次性支出:1000元
总计:5000元
6.1.3非一次性支出
a. 设备的更新和维护费用:1000元/年
b. 软件的更新和维护费用:100元/年
c. 公用设备,如机房的水电支出:10000元/年
d. 其他经常性支出;1000元/年
总计:12100元
假设系统运行四年,那么四年内的系统投资成本总额为:
6000+5000+12100*4=59400元
6.2收益
管理方式自动化,减少了人力,节省了成本;学生上机消费人数将会增多,收益将会增加
6.2.2非一次性收益
减少了人力,节约了教师成本。
6.2.3不可定量的收益
上机的学生将会越来越多,收益将会增加,年收益大于年支出。
6.3收益/投资比
7/3
6.4投资回收周期
投资回收周期为:六个月
6.5敏感性分析
暂无
7社会因素方面的可行性
7.1法律方面的可行性
本系统作为软件工程这门课程的课程设计,没有签订任何合同,不存在合同责任;所用的东西都是自己的或公共的,不存在侵权问题。
7.2使用方面的可行性
只需要一个管理员和相关的操作员、一般用户即可,系统简单易操作,需要相关的计算机方面的知识即可;账目信息核对有保障 。
8结论
机房收费系统的投入运行,极大极大节省了学校的开支情况,使得机房管理更加规范化。从技术、法律、以及效益方面看,该项目可以立即进行开发。